An Experimental Procedure to Determine the Effects of Wear and Deterioration on Engine Vibration Signature.

Abstract

This paper describes an experimental procedure to determine the effects of wear and deterioration on the vibration signature of a reciprocating engine. Power spectral density analysis is the evaluation technique proposed. The experiment is designed to show that by closely following changes in the power spectral density plots, the engines internal condition can be determined. The report describes the results of initial experimentation and provides detailed procedures for continuance of the project.
